InLeadershipIsanArt(1989),DePreeassertsthat"thefirstresponsibilityofaleaderistodefine reality".Bennis(1990)writesthatleaders"managethedream".Visionisdefinedas"theforce whichmoldsmeaningforthepeopleofanorganization"byManasse(1986)

AccordingtoManasse,thisaspectofleadershipis"visionaryleadership"andincludesfourdifferent typesofvision:organization,future,personal,andstrategic.Organizationalvisioninvolveshavinga completepictureofasystem'scomponentsaswellasanunderstandingoftheirinterrelationships. "Futurevisionisacomprehensivepictureofhowanorganizationwilllookatsomepointinthe future,includinghowitwillbepositionedinitsenvironmentandhowitwillfunctioninternally" (Manasse,1986).Personalvisionincludestheleader'spersonalaspirationsfortheorganizationand actsastheimpetusfortheleader'sactionsthatwilllinkorganizationalandfuturevision"Strategic visioninvolvesconnectingtherealityofthepresent(organizationalvision)tothepossibilitiesofthe future(futurevision)inauniqueway(personalvision)thatisappropriatefortheorganizationand itsleader"(Manasse,1986).Aleader'svisionneedstobesharedbythosewhowillbeinvolvedin therealizationofthevision.

b.Behavioraltheories.

Insteadoffocusingonpersonalitytraits,behavioraltheoriesfocusonthebehaviorofeffective leaders.Thisdistinctionisveryimportantbecauseifbehavioraltheoriesprovedtobetruethey wouldmeanthatpeoplecanbetrainedtobecomebetterleaders,incontrasttothetraittheories, whichassumedthatcharacteristicsthatmadethedifferencebetweenleadersandnonleaderswere giventoanindividualandcouldn'tbechanged,thusleavingorganizationswiththerecruiting processofselectingtherightleaderastheonlytooltowardseffectivenessandlittlehopeforany improvement.
